Concept:
The coefficient of detention is given by:
\(\frac{{Friction\;force\;at\;sleeve}}{{Weight\;of\;ball + Weight \; of \; sleeve}}= \frac{f}{{(M+m)g}} \)
Calculation:
Given:
Weight of the sleeve = 200 N, ball weight = 50 N, Friction force (f) = 10 N.
The coefficient of detention will be
Coefficient of detention \(= \frac{{10}}{{(200+50)}}\)
Coefficient of detention = 0.04
